Objective:

  • Make informed decisions on which maintenance activities should be outsourced and which should remain in-house
  • Understand the benefits of lean maintenance contracts and how they improve efficiency and cost effectiveness
  • Select and apply appropriate maintenance contract models, including Service Level Agreements (SLAs)
  • Define service levels and establish performance monitoring systems for contractor accountability
  • Develop and negotiate effective maintenance contracts aligned with organizational objectives
  • Identify and mitigate common risks associated with maintenance outsourcing
  • Evaluate contractor and stakeholder performance to ensure successful contract delivery
  • Implement effective maintenance contract management practices for continuous operational improvement

Content:

Outsourcing Considerations in Maintenance Management

  • Introduction to maintenance outsourcing
  • Asset management and the business impact of maintenance activities
  • Determining which maintenance activities to outsource and retain internally
  • Understanding risks associated with outsourcing maintenance services

Maintenance Contracts and Contractor Selection

  • Understanding different types of maintenance contracts
  • Identifying key parties involved in maintenance contracting
  • Modern approaches to the tendering process
  • Selecting the right maintenance contractor
  • Costing maintenance services effectively
  • Defining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for contractor performance monitoring
  • Applying the Balanced Scorecard approach in performance-based contracts

Developing Effective Maintenance Contracts

  • Understanding vendor management principles
  • Managing the maintenance contracting cycle
  • Building an effective contract management team
  • Assessing and defining required service levels
  • Developing the key components of a maintenance contract
  • Implementing contract performance management systems
  • Conducting periodic contract evaluations and improvement reviews

Contract Negotiation and Risk-Based Maintenance Strategies

  • Managing expectations around availability, reliability, and maintenance costs
  • Understanding preventive maintenance schedules and contractor practices
  • Developing risk-based maintenance concepts
  • Using maintenance strategies to negotiate effective lean contracts
  • Applying negotiation tactics and techniques in maintenance contracting
  • Practical negotiation tips for achieving successful outcomes

Final Workshop: Developing a Maintenance Contract

  • Group development of a maintenance contract
  • Defining service requirements and performance levels
  • Preparing maintenance service proposals
  • Establishing contractor selection criteria
  • Presenting and evaluating bids
  • Contract closing and implementation planning
  • Reviewing results and identifying improvement opportunities
